Page 14: ...nto a suitable single socket Starting up Adjustment 1 Switch the appliance on with the ON OFF key The appliance starts after 30 seconds The light ring is lit in green or lilac during start up When the start up process is finished the light ring is lit in blue yellow or red depending on the air quality The colours correspond to the following air quality Blue very good air quality PM 2 5 75 μg m Yel...

Page 16: ... at the rear wall of the appliance to remove the rear wall 3 Remove the filter 4 Take a new filter out of its packaging To order the filter use art No 850210 5 Insert the new filter in the appliance 6 Close the rear wall with the locking ring ...
